Output d57115b9d96aa1f3c53526e77d347050645c406a7516a7a072c9a4f6248422eb:1

value
18741344
script pubkey
OP_0 OP_PUSHBYTES_20 d5df29035087acc89ee65e3991fa1a6e1b768532
address
tb1q6h0jjq6ss7kv38hxtcuer7s6dcdhdpfjyw9j4n
transaction
d57115b9d96aa1f3c53526e77d347050645c406a7516a7a072c9a4f6248422eb